Arlington, Pittsburgh, PA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Arlington?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Arlington 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,775 | $950 | $6,000 |
Arlington 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,606 | $950 | $10,000+ |
Arlington 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,952 | $650 | $2,975 |
Arlington 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,208 | $500 | $3,100 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Arlington
What type of rentals are currently available in Arlington?
There are currently 525 Apartments for Rent in Arlington, PA with pricing that ranges from $550 to $13,901. There are also 164 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Arlington ranging from $500 to $20,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Arlington?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Arlington ranges from $500 to $20,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,890.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Arlington?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Arlington range from $600 to $5,997,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$950 to $20,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$800.
